#b55cf6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b55cf6 is composed of 71% red, 36.1% green and 96.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.4% cyan, 62.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 274.7 degrees, a saturation of 89.5% and a lightness of 66.3%. #b55cf6 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b8ff with #6b00ed.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

Shades and Tints of #b55cf6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030004 is the darkest color, while #f9f1f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#b55cf6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aaa5ad is the less saturated color, while #b655fd is the most saturated one.
